Created a #define for magic number.
Because running pumps in open loop mode (because we're priming and not necessarily any fluid in line to measure flow with) and pumps have different methods of determining PWM duty cycle from a given flow rate, DPo pumps target flow rate needed to be set lower to match the duty cycle with DPi pump.
